How Our Flood Water Extraction Process Works
Our technicians use specialized equipment to extract water quickly and efficiently, reducing further damage. We follow a meticulous process to ensure your property is restored to its original condition.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We assess the affected area to find out the best course of action. Our team develops a customized plan to extract water, dry the space, and restore your property.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ove standing water, reducing the risk of mold growth and further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our equipment helps to dry the affected area, removing excess moisture and preventing secondary damage.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to remove dirt, debris, and bacteria from the affected area.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Our team works with you to restore your property to its original condition, including repairs, painting, and refinishing.

Flood Water Extraction Cost in Lakewood, WA
The cost of flood water extraction in Lakewood, WA varies based on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on our experience and may not reflect your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Type of surfaces affected, extent of cleaning needed, and equipment required |
| Restoration and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Scope of repairs, materials needed, and labor required |
| Moisture testing and inspection |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of the job, and equipment needed |
| Emergency services (e.g., 24/7 response) | $200 – $1,000 | Severity of the situation, time of day, and equipment required |
